Clars April Fine Art & Antique Auction, Day 2

Featuring the Estate of Rebecca and Seymour Fromer, founder of the Judah Magnes Museum, Berkeley, CA. Fine Art including works by Tom Blackwell, George Gardner Symons, Mary DeNeale Morgan, Rufino Tamayo and Joan Miro. Furniture and Decoratives include a pair of black forest carved hall chairs, Romeo Rega dining suite, Art pottery, art glass and fine sterling silver. Jewelry is highlighted by pocket watch enclosing an erotic automaton, and a sapphire and diamond ring. Asian Arts is offering Chinese jade and hardstone carvings, ceramics, scholars objects, metalwork, snuff bottles, paintings and furniture; Japanese cloisonne enamel, prints and paintings.
